WebWhile Texas law does not require any formal paperwork to document a change in firearm ownership, a bill of sale is a strong recommendation. WebDec 22, 2024 · The transfer of a firearm across state lines must be done through a Federal Firearm Licensee (FFL) if you want to gift a firearm to someone outside of your home state. Ask them if they know of someone looking, or if they are personally looking, to buy a new … pair of beach chairsWebApr 11, 2024 · Subsections (a) (3) and (a) (5) prohibits the transfer of firearms across state lines for unlicensed individuals with some exceptions. Subsection (b) (3) prohibits the transfer of firearms by licensed dealers to individuals who reside in a different state unless the laws of both states allow it or it is a temporary sporting loan.
